CARIBOU – Bernice St. Peter, 88, wife of the late Aurele St. Peter, died April 21, 2013, in Caribou. She was born May 1, 1924, in Caribou, the daughter of the late Joseph and Laura (Ouellette) Caron.
Mrs. St. Peter was a lifelong member of Sacred Heart Catholic Church where she was a member of Ladies of St. Anne. Bernice was a homemaker for many years until the death of her husband, Aurele in 1973, where she then sought employment at Caribou Nursing Home. Bernice was a loving and devoted wife, mother and grandmother to her family. She loved to crochet afghans for her family and friends. Many will remember her for her fine cooking skills, the many delicious meals she prepared and how much she loved to cook for everyone, whether it was just for a few individuals or for many large family gatherings.
She is survived by her children, Norma LaMothe and husband, Claude, of Caribou, Patrick St. Peter and wife, Jean Marie, of Limestone, Richard St. Peter and wife, Eleanor, Linda Ala and husband, John, Judy Gengler and husband, Lyle, and Lori Theriault and husband, Roddy, all of Caribou. 12 grandchildren; 17 great-grandchildren; and recently, her first great-great-grandson. Bernice also had the love of many brothers and sisters as well as many nieces and nephews.
Friends may call 6-8 p.m. Tuesday, at Mockler Funeral Home, 24 Reservoir St., Caribou. A Mass of Christian burial will be celebrated 10 a.m. Wednesday, April 24, at Parish of the Precious Blood, Sacred Heart Catholic Church. After the service all are invited to a time of continued fellowship and refreshments at the parish hall. Interment will be in the spring at Sacred Heart Cemetery. www.mocklerfuneralhome.com.
